Direct Action

A form of political or social activism that seeks immediate remedy to perceived injustices, often through methods outside of institutional channels.

NAACP

The National Association for the Advancement of Colored People is a civil rights organization in the United States, formed in 1909, aimed at advocating for the rights and improving the lives of African Americans.

Spadework

Preliminary or foundational work that prepares for the main project, task, or effort, often involving hard or tedious tasks.

White Power Structure

The dominance of white individuals in positions of power within societal structures, contributing to racial inequality and privilege.
